1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the Internet in which a protracted URL could be transformed right into a shorter, far more manageable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the original lengthy URL when visited. Solutions like Bitly and TinyURL are well-identified exam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social media platforms like Twitter, exactly where character limits for posts manufactured it tough to share lengthy URLs.

Over and above social media marketing, URL shorteners are helpful in advertising campaigns, e-mail, and printed media in which long URLs is often cumbersome.

2. Core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ically contains the subsequent components:

World-wide-web Interface: Here is the front-stop aspect wherever users can enter their lengthy URLs and obtain shortened versions. It may be a straightforward type with a web page.
Database: A databases is essential to retail store the mapping between the original extended URL as well as shortened Variation.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L options like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This is actually the backend logic that will take the short URL and redirects the user for the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is usually carried out in the online server or an application layer.
API: A lot of URL shorteners give an API in order that third-celebration pur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ial prolonged URLs.
three. Creating the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a lengthy URL into a short one particular. A number of procedures may be employed, which include:

Hashing: The long URL can be hashed into a set-size string, which serves as being the quick URL. However, hash collisions (different URLs leading to the same hash) have to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one popular method is to implement Base62 encoding (which utilizes sixty two characters: 0-9, A-Z, and also a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to the entry inside the databases. This process makes sure that the limited URL is as shorter as possible.
Random String Generation: Yet another technique will be to deliver a random string of a hard and fast duration (e.g., six figures) and Test if it’s presently in use in the databases. Otherwise, it’s assigned on the very long URL.
four. Database Management
The database schema for just a URL shortener is frequently clear-cut, with two Most important fields:

ID: A unique identifier for every URL entry.
Long UR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Short URL/Slug: The quick Variation of the URL, usually stored as a novel string.
In combination with these, you might like to retail outlet metadata including the creation date, expiration date, and the quantity of situations the brief URL has become accessed.

five. Managing Redirection
Redirection is a crucial Portion of the URL shortener's operation. Each time a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the assistance really should quickly retrieve the original URL in the database and redirect the user utilizing an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) status code.

General performance is key in this article, as the method should be virtually instantaneous. Techniques like database indexing and caching (e.g., applying Redis or Memcached) could be used to speed up the retrieval method.

six. Security Criteria
Security is a major issue in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ener could be abused to unfold destructive hyperlinks.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-bash security providers to examine UR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this risk.
Spam Prevention: Price limiting and CAPTCHA can avert abuse by spammers endeavoring to generate A huge number of limited URLs.
seven. Scalability
As being the URL shortener grows, it might require to take care of millions of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, possibly invol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ute visitors across multiple servers to handle high h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into unique exp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ners frequently provide anal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, exactly where the traffic is coming from, and various practical metrics. This calls for logging Each and every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
